This episode of Capitol Crimes, Shattered Trust, tells the stories of legislators trying to stem the rampant corruption that plagues our state and reverse the moniker of most corrupt state in the union. Their attempts to rebuild the trust of Illinoisans continue to be thwarted by those leading the General Assembly. Nevertheless, Illinois State Representatives Ryan Spain, Amy Elik and other lawmakers continue to push the majority to take effective action to end the culture of corruption in Illinois.
